About Program

Program Overview


This four-year Physics program provides a comprehensive foundation in physics, with a focus on quantum systems, electromagnetism, and astrophysics. Students develop computational and analytical skills, and engage in research projects guided by Trinity professors. The program prepares graduates for careers in physics, medical physics, education, research, and various high-tech industries.

Program Outline


Outline:

  • Year 1 and 2:
  • Students study modules common to all students in the Physical Sciences stream.
  • Year 3:
  • Physics of quantum systems
  • Electromagnetism
  • Collective behaviours underpinning condensed matter
  • Electronic and physical structure of materials
  • Astrophysics of galaxies and stars
  • Observational astrophysical and spectroscopic analysis techniques
  • Computational physics
  • Experimental techniques
  • Semiconductor physics and devices
  • Advanced laboratory experiments with a focus on science communication skills
  • Trinity Elective modules in non-science subjects
  • Year 4:
  • Advanced modules in:
  • Planetary science
  • Space science
  • Cosmology
  • Advanced quantum mechanics
  • Nuclear and particle physics
  • Advanced electromagnetism
  • Problem solving
  • Computational physics
  • Magnetism
  • Photonics
  • Energy science
  • Individual Capstone research project in astrophysics or physics, guided by Trinity professors and conducted within their research groups or with collaborating institutes or universities

Other:

  • Students are encouraged to apply physics to the universe at large and develop computational skills.
  • Research training culminates in the individual Capstone research project carried out in the final year.
  • Students typically become skilled in analysis of observations, computer simulations, and handling and analyzing large datasets.
  • Many students undertake research internships in Trinity or other universities during the summer vacation.
  • Students have won scholarships to work in research laboratories between third and fourth years from the Dublin Institute for Advanced Studies, Armagh Observatory, or the Dutch research agency ASTRON.
